How to Solve a Daily Themed Crossword
How the daily and mini grids are built, and the order that solves them.
Read the theme before the clues
Daily Themed Crossword builds every puzzle around one idea, and the long entries almost always belong to it. Knowing the theme turns those from cold clues into a guessing game with a very short list.
Fill the short crossings first
Three and four letter answers use the most predictable vocabulary in the whole grid. Each one you place hands letters to the long clues for free, which is a better use of the first minute than staring at the hardest entry.
Abbreviations are signposted
A clue ending in "Abbr." or containing its own abbreviation is telling you the answer is short and clipped. The same goes for "Hyph." and "2 wds." — the clue format is half the answer.
